Position Overview

The Director of Strategic Development is a senior leader responsible for driving NET’s growth, sustainability, and long-term vision. This role blends strategic planning, business development, fundraising, and partnership-building to ensure NET thrives in a competitive and evolving landscape. The ideal candidate is a visionary strategist with proven experience in grant procurement, donor advancement, and cross-sector partnerships, combined with strong leadership and communications skills.

This is a full-time, exempt position. The successful candidate will report to the Executive Director and manage all Development Department employees.

Responsibilities Strategic Development
  • Responsible for developing and executing strategic initiatives to achieve organizational objectives and drive growth
  • Works with the Executive Director to promote organizational sustainability and growth
  • Provides strategic leadership to internal teams and external partners
  • Works closely with senior leadership to set goals, communicate strategies, and guide the organization toward its vision
  • Addresses challenges that arise during the strategic planning and implementation process, such as shifts in the competitive landscape or regulatory changes
  • Researches and analyzes market trends to identify new opportunities and potential challenges
  • Leads the organization's business development in seeking new revenue streams and forming strategic partnerships
  • Identifies multi-channel opportunities and plans that supports sustainable growth, strengthens donor engagement and achieves annual goals
  • Establishes and maintains strong relationships with external partners, such as elected offices, agency representatives, and key partners to facilitate collaboration and drive strategic partnerships
Grants
  • Leads and oversees public and private-sector grant procurement
  • Solicits gifts and corporate sponsor ships, creating annual campaigns, producing special events, and managing donor cultivation efforts
  • Provides support as needed for fund solicitation
  • Develops and implements the fundraising plan in concert with organizational strategic priorities
  • Performs and/or manages government, foundation, subgranting, and corporate opportunities
  • Leads team assessment of new grant opportunities through regular consultative grant strategy workshops with senior staff
  • Recommends grant programs and applications that progress NET’s priorities and mission
  • Attends community meetings and participates in webinars and grant related workshops
  • Leads the cultivation and, management of relationships with grant program staff
  • With a view towards successful implementation, provides guidance and assistance to NET project staff
  • Responsible for grant budget development and new project hand off to department leads and project managers
  • Supports grant compliance and reporting requirements
Donor Advancement
  • Cultivates and stewards’ donors at all levels
  • Researches, builds relationships, and seeks funding from foundations, corporations, business groups, individuals
  • Develops, implements, and expands NET’s annual gifts campaign, including monthly donations, crowdfunding, corporate matching, stock donations, charitable distributions, corporate sponsor ships
  • Provides ongoing cultivation and stewardship of donors at all levels
  • Co-leads the utilization and management of NET’s donor relationship management system, ensuring timely and accurate record keeping and timely donor acknowledgment
  • Oversees social media and website fundraising in collaboration with Development Manager
  • Supports goal of 100% Board participation in fundraising efforts
  • Works with the Executive Director and Board of Directors to build a culture of resource development and philanthropy throughout the organization
  • Supports and helps the Board fundraising committee to best achieve fundraising plans
  • Assists with Board development and onboarding
  • Builds, maintains, and grows relationships with nonprofit conservation organizations, federal and state agencies, tribal governments, and other public and private stakeholders
  • Oversees the Donor Management System
